write.as

Buying Multi Model Databases

The Definitive Strategy for Multi Model Databases When it has to do with databases, it's simple to get lost in the many definitions. As a consequence the exact same database can be seen in many diverse ways. For the application to stay online, each one of the databases have to remain up. It follows that ArangoDB won't get the job done for graph databases if ArangoDB doesn't support Tinkerpop. Multiple DbContext make sense should they represent two distinct databases, though in our example we've used single database for the two contexts. If you take advantage of a multi-tenant design, you'll need to think about how to move one particular tenant to some other database if that's required. That's the crux of the database engine that enables us to support applications without a latency and enables us to support the exact massive applications which exist in the enterprise. While developers need numerous data models, they need ton't need to adopt distinctive databases to receive them. An international database administrator (DBA) is accountable for the whole system. Defining your databases The very first step to using more than 1 database with Django is to tell Django concerning the database servers you'll use. Actually, we're the very first NoSQL database to allow this feature. JSON isn't a replacement for the exiting relational models, and there are a few particular use cases when you need to utilize JSON in SQL Database. There are various rules and requirements as soon as it regards the use of every one of these databases. Multi-tenant databases are advantageous whenever there are a huge number of relatively inactive tenants. MarkLogic's approach was shown to be a whole lot more flexible and offers a much faster time-to-market than a relational database strategy to similar difficulties. In a mixed database environment, it is worth it to share a normal method of expressing data schemas, in addition to having a common method of transfer. If you've got them in memory, and there is not too many, they're fast. Most database developers will tell you traditional relational SQL databases aren't ideally suited for agile improvement. Additionally, synchronization of these databases is an issue that maynot be dismissed. It's the very first cloud database to natively support an abundance of data models and popular query APIs, is constructed on a novel database engine capable of ingesting sustained volumes of information and gives blazing-fast queries all without having to address schema or index administration. JSON documents also offer the additional advantage of having the ability to index individual values making the access a whole lot more performant, allowing pieces of information from other documents to be joined together. A main key can be defined on more than 1 column, therefore we'll use both these columns as the main key for the subsequent table. Execution time was approximately two seconds for the traditional table irrespective of the quantity of attributes. For instance, if a branch library is deleted as a result of closure, the books they haven't transferred out might be deleted also. This provides you a semantic view of varied databases and one place where it's possible to look up every simple fact which you have. Be aware that I'm not attempting to enumerate all the correct use cases for each form of database could be appropriate. Type of Multi Model Databases Since you may see, this is a rather strong set of operations that may be employed to manipulate data. Isolation usually means all transactions have to be independent of one another. It's not uncommon in the present applications that the intermediate effect of a single query needs to be used for another. Since they operate completely separate from different tenants, they aren't bound by the exact limitations as multi-tenancy customers. We chose not to utilize Apartment's elevator system to change tenants. By way of example, several competing companies wish to keep up a joint staff directory for the advantage of their mutual clients. Once more, you will probably invest lots of effort to create a non-general system that doesn't have the necessary efficiency. There are some things we must remember before we jump in to configuring our solution. As https://www.predictiveanalyticstoday.com/top-multi-model-databases/ would like to concentrate on new, innovative and intriguing topics around SAP technoploy with deep insights and fun to understand about doing it. Whatever sort of database you are using in supporting a business, there is not any escaping the need to comprehend the data. In a nutshell, the range of data structures we now should manage has changed dramatically. The issue is that it just doesn't get the job done for cloud-scale distributed applications. In many instances, there's no issue providing shared read access. Price This one is pretty simple. You should cooperate with your users to establish whether the amount of dimensions makes your solution too intricate and therefore limiting the population of users or boosts the simplicity of use and thus expanding the user population. Nowadays, a new non-relational database type referred to as NoSQL' is gaining traction in the enterprise as a substitute model for database administration. Device database use cases consist of promotional campaigns for a certain set of goods or print materials. Features like data masking can enable organizations to give guard rails for users to make certain they stay inside their purview of information,'' Leone explained. When you use a single-database model with numerous tenants, it's clearly likely to be a database that you have and are accountable for. If you own a circumstance where the load placed by different tenants varies, you're likely to locate life much simpler if you have separate databases. In this instance, WidgetCo would make a new account for PhoneCo to use. Cypher's popularity has risen tremendously over the last couple of decades. This program is provided as a resource which you're welcome to access as you see fit, but it's impossible to make a Statement of Accomplishment at this moment. Therefore, it can filter data based on the present tenant's id.